Quick answer: No, Importify does not work with every e-commerce website. As of September 3, 2026, Importify officially supports stores on Shopify, Wix, WooCommerce, BigCommerce and Jumpseller. It can import product data from DHgate and more than 25 other listed supplier marketplaces, but compatibility depends on both sides of the workflow: the store platform and the source marketplace.

Which store platforms does Importify support?
| Store platform | Officially listed? | Setup route |
|---|---|---|
| Shopify | Yes | Install through the Shopify App Store |
| Wix | Yes | Install through the Wix App Market |
| WooCommerce | Yes | Install the WordPress plugin and connect Importify |
| BigCommerce | Yes | Install through the BigCommerce app marketplace |
| Jumpseller | Yes | Use the Jumpseller installation route |
| Other or custom storefronts | Not generally listed | Ask Importify support before assuming compatibility |
Importify’s official compatibility page names those five destination platforms. A site being “an e-commerce website” is not enough: the tool needs a supported store connection, permissions and a product-catalog workflow it understands.
Can Importify import products from DHgate?
Yes. Importify’s current DHgate guide says its browser extension can bring DHgate product data into a connected Shopify, Wix, WooCommerce, BigCommerce or Jumpseller store. The product should enter your store as material to review—not as a finished listing ready to publish.
- Connect Importify to a supported store platform.
- Install the supported browser extension and open the DHgate product page.
- Import the product data into Importify.
- Check the title, description, images, variants, SKU, price and shipping information.
- Remove any content or images you do not have permission to use.
- Publish only after verifying the supplier and the product’s legal and operational fit.
Importify states that DHgate order placement and supplier communication remain manual. Its current documentation limits fully automated order fulfillment to AliExpress. Do not assume importing a listing also automates purchasing, tracking, returns or customer support.
What Importify compatibility does not prove
A successful import proves only that the software can transfer supported listing fields. It does not prove that:
- the DHgate seller is reliable;
- the product is authentic, safe or legal to resell;
- stock, variants or shipping estimates are current;
- supplier images and descriptions are licensed for your store;
- orders will be fulfilled automatically;
- your store platform or payment provider permits the product.
Importify’s own terms say it does not control third-party suppliers or guarantee product claims, legality, availability, shipping or suitability for resale. Apply DHgateWiki’s seller identity checks and seller-claim verification process before using imported information.
How to test the workflow before scaling
- Confirm both endpoints. Check that your store and the supplier marketplace appear in Importify’s current official documentation.
- Run one test import. Use a low-risk, non-branded product and compare every imported field with the source page.
- Edit the listing. Write original customer-facing copy, verify variants and remove unlicensed media.
- Map the order process. Document who places the supplier order, uploads tracking and handles cancellations or returns.
- Test a real order. Use a controlled sample before adding many products or promising delivery times.

Bottom line
Importify is compatible with five named store platforms, not every e-commerce site. DHgate is a supported product source, but the connection is primarily an import-and-edit workflow; DHgate fulfillment remains manual. Verify the latest platform list, test one product end to end and treat supplier content as unverified source material.
